AE Wealth Management LLC increased its position in shares of Fidelity MSCI Communication Services Index ETF (NYSEARCA:FCOM – Free Report) by 7.3% during the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 119,757 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 8,122 shares during the period. AE Wealth Management LLC owned 0.48% of Fidelity MSCI Communication Services Index ETF worth $7,761,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Fidelity MSCI Communication Services Index ETF Company Profile
The Fidelity MSCI Communication Services Index ETF (FCOM)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in communication services equity. The fund tracks a market-cap-weighted index of stocks in the US communication services sector. FCOM was launched on Oct 21, 2013 and is managed by Fidelity.
